Installation/Registration of Accessory Handset

Expand your i 5871 system by adding accessory handsets. Bring telephone service to rooms where a phone jack isn’t available!

Your VTech i 5871 system can operate up to eight handsets. To order additional handsets (model number i 5808), visit us on the web at www.vtechphones.com or call VTech Customer Service at 1-800-595-9511. In Canada, call 1-800-267-7377.

As you register additional handsets to the system, they will be assigned extension num- bers in the following order: HANDSET 2, HANDSET 3, etc.

Whenever charged handset batteries are installed, the handset will automatically begin Searching for Base... (if previously registered), or it will prompt you to register the new handset.
